Nick Roberts <nickrob@snap.net.nz> writes:
> Does log-view-mode do what you want? Do `C-x v l' and then `d' on
> the appropriate line of the vc-change-log buffer (See VC status node
> in the manual).
I didn't know about the `d' command (thanks), but the usage is kinda
klunky what with the popping between the different buffers and how you
have to run the cursor around to get to the next/prev diff.
I'm mainly aiming for ease of use here -- scanning through a range of
diffs very easily (one keystroke) and quickly.
